Kurzbeschreibung (Abstract)

Due to the reduction of conventional electricity generation within the German grid new challenges arise. One of those challenges is how reactive power can be provided for the voltage regulation of the grid. A possible way to provide reactive power is the utilization of free converter capacities in the lower voltage levels. This paper focuses on the provision of reactive power by means of flexible industry consumers in the LV-network. The characteristics of an existing factory, which is intended for scientific research, at Technische Universität Darmstadt are used as an example of a flexible industry consumer. The reactive power provision capability for different levels of grid penetration with flexible factories is evaluated. In addition to the reactive power provision potential, the impact on the local distribution grid of the campus is analyzed.
